Summary

Principal Gilligan

  • School website needs updating. Would like to replace it. Waiting for DOE budget to say how much he can spend on a website vendor.
  • Discussed recess support; reiterated that the school does not think it is good to have parent volunteers at recess.
  • School test scores increased in literacy and math; erased the pandemic losses and this will hopefully improve our school’s ranking in the city.
  • School uses flexible seating, so students may sit on the floor or in other configurations; this is for different needs and is used as a support, never a punishment; used in consultation with families to benefit students
  • Principal Gilligan will talk with the head of the school food department to see what can be done about the broken salad bar machine, and will see if the lunch staff can serve salad from the kitchen.
  • Parents expressed concern about crowding during dismissal at the 52nd street gate; there is not enough space for strollers to pass that area and parents and kids are walking in the street; there is also no crossing guard this year; Principal Gilligan said he will talk to teachers about having one grade per day come into the yard early for pick up and allow parents in, which might ease congestion.
  • Parents asked what students do during indoor recess; Principal Gilligan said staff does their best to play games (Simon Says, etc.) and students can bring books to read, but main activity is often a video.

Treasurer's Report

  • Presented by Christopher Canfield, Co-Treasurer
  • Covered 7/1/2023 through 10/17/2023
  • Filed IRS Form 8868 to request extension for Form 990, as we continue to not have access to all financial accounts that existed last year.
  • We need to complete an internal audit.
